Summary | 0057830: Problem with duplicity of lines when generating issue from “Issue Distribution Order”. | |||||||||||
Description | When we generate a DOI issue from the “Issue Distribution Order” window manually, for some reason a line is duplicated generating additional erroneous movements. | |||||||||||

(0175063) vmromanos (manager) 2025-02-03 14:22 |
I think you are not using the functionality properly. See documentation: https://wiki.openbravo.com/wiki/Projects/Distribution_Orders/User_Document#Issue_Distribution_Order [^] Usually you just want to create the header, populate the DO and In Transit bin fields, and press the Generate Issue button, which will automatically create the lines with the available stock. I don't understand what you are trying to do in the video and what you pretend the Generate Issue button to perform if you create manual lines with a new bin different from the In-Transit bin at the header. |
